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Treorchy to Fairbourne start from as little as £22.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Treorchy to Fairbourne are available for £51.80 one way, or £58.10 return

Facilities and Features at Treorchy Station

Treorchy station might not have a ticket office, but it makes up with accessible ticket machines that accept major debit and credit cards, ensuring you can collect tickets bought online with ease. While the station doesn't issue smartcards, validators are available for commuters who carry them. Travelers who rely on technology for travel planning will be pleased to know that public Wi-Fi is accessible—helping you stay connected while you wait for your train.

For those requiring assistance, there's a help point available. Travel information is displayed on departure and arrival screens, and announcements keep passengers updated on the latest travel news. Unfortunately, there's no waiting room, but a seating area offers some comfort as you wait for your ride. Access around the station is partially step-free, with a ramp with a steep gradient available from Station Road. It's important to plan ahead if you require full accessibility support.

Getting to and Beyond Treorchy Station

Treorchy station is seamlessly connected to public transport. For times when rail services might be disrupted, a rail replacement service operates towards Pontypridd near the Prince of Wales pub and towards Treherbert near Morgan's Barbers on the A4058. While the station lacks designated spaces or equipment for aiding passenger's mobility in its car park, it offers free parking with 24-hour access.

Facilities and Amenities at Fairbourne Station

Despite its quaint size, Fairbourne train station provides the essentials for travelers. While there isn't a ticket office or ticket machines available, purchasing tickets online in advance is recommended to avoid inconvenience. The station offers step-free access, with ramps facilitating movement between platforms, which is categorized as B2, indicating partial accessibility. However, patrons should note the lack of waiting rooms, seating areas, and refreshment facilities on-site. Moreover, the station does not feature luggage storage or toilet facilities, though there is an induction loop available for those with hearing impairments.
